Default PT 9.0.3 Still Having Grid Issues.

Hello,
I noticed on the previous protools version, grid divisions (In slip mode only it seemed) were set by whatever zoom level you were at. This bothered me a lot. The first time ever the digiupdater app actually did anything, it told me to update, and I get protools 9.0.3 without having to navigate Avid or Digi's website

Anyways... It seems the grid has gone back to normal, and now stays where you set it, in slip, grid, rel grid, spot and whatever zoom level you may be at.

My problem now is, when I want to change the beat divisions to triplets, the grid changes properly, but the 'Bar Beat' divisions at the top of the Edit page remain on set to whatever even note division you have selected. IE Triplet 16th grid displays beat divisions; 1|000 1|120 1|240 1|360. (not triplet timing)

The drummer I'm editing plays fast, and goes between triplets and even beats all the time. The songs are also really long and extremely technical, which makes not having my numbers line up make this troublesome.

Obviously I can still edit, but this is almost as bad as the crazy shifting grid.

Anyone else notice this?

EDIT: Sorry just noticed my grid comes back with proper bar beat divisions, but only while using grid tool. Is this how this should really work?

If I pick a grid, triplet or not, and specific divisions, I want it to be displayed like that. ALWAYS. No matter what tool, no matter what zoom level. I edit a lot with the slip tool, and the bar beat divisions decide to not follow the grid for some reason. Should be bar beat divisions not ALWAYS follow what your grid is displaying? I think that would make more sense.

If someone has a reason for the bar beat divisions to be shifting around constantly, and not line up to your grid, please, enlighten me.
